Reviewers suggest the beef effect may be the saturated fat or ldl cholesterol, the iron-mediated oxidized fat or the salt, however it can additionally be the TMAO. The carnitine in meat and the choline in dairy, seafood, and specifically eggs is converted with the aid of our intestine micro organism into trimethylamine, which is oxidized through our liver to TMAO, which may then make contributions to coronary heart assaults, stroke, and death.

And certainly, within a 2019 research published inside the Journal of the American Medical Association following tens of lots of Americans for a mean of about 17 years, as much as a maximum of 31 years, discovered that “better consumption of nutritional ldl cholesterol or eggs turned into extensively associated with better risk of incident cardiovascular ailment and all-purpose mortality, in a dose-answer manner.” Meaning individuals who ate more eggs or fed on greater ldl cholesterol in general regarded to live significantly shorter lives, on average, and the extra the eggs, the more severe it became––and this consists of egg intake and stroke.

It might seem moderation of egg intake is called for, along with other sources of dietary ldl cholesterol, given the new poll records, which had the benefit of a “longer observe-up than most people of the previous reports and can [therefore] have furnished extra energy to stumble on associations.” Similarly, with meta-analyses of dairy, no obvious link emerged, but proof of e-book bias become located––which means there seemed to be missing reports, potentially shelved via industry-funded researchers for now not showing funder-friendly results. Researchers analyzing the connection among investment assets and conclusions within reports of sugary drinks and milk located that experiences funded by means of the likes of Coca-Cola or the Dairy Council had over seven instances the likelihood of coming to funder-friendly conclusions than unbiased research––which is two times as awful as drug organizations.

Big Pharma best appears on the way to escape with a 3-fold bias.

Of precise interest, no longer a single one of the interventional experiences looking at soda or milk ended up with an adverse conclusion.

The backside line is that sure, dairy fats may be higher than different animal fat, which include the ones observed in meat, however something like entire grains would be better nonetheless––even though swapping dairy out for refined grains or added sugar wouldn’t be doing you many favors.

When it involves stroke hazard, vegetable fat is higher than dairy fat, meat fats is the worst, whole grains are higher, and fish fats, introduced sugars, or subtle grains are statistically about the equal.

In phrases of nutritional patterns and stroke, most of the stories on plant-based totally dietary patterns have discovered a shielding effect against stroke, while the ones searching at Westernized styles, those primarily based extra on animal ingredients and delivered sugars and fat, found a unfavourable effect of the adherence to Westernized patterns.
